Immigrants from Western Africa vs Central American Indian Wage/Income Gap Correlation Chart
The statistical analysis conducted on geographies consisting of 357,735,859 people shows a weak negative correlation between the proportion of Immigrants from Western Africa and wage/income gap percentage in the United States with a correlation coefficient (R) of -0.289 and weighted average of 22.0%. Similarly, the statistical analysis conducted on geographies consisting of 325,982,547 people shows a weak negative correlation between the proportion of Central American Indians and wage/income gap percentage in the United States with a correlation coefficient (R) of -0.204 and weighted average of 22.7%, a difference of 2.8%.
